66.181.34.39 checked at 2025-02-22T17:13:46.280Z 988ms 4/4/4 100% R:5
DNSTREE.COM - 66.181.34.39
Search for IP or hostnames
dbq
Search for IP or hostnames
66.181.34.39 checked at 2025-02-22T17:13:46.280Z 988ms 4/4/4 100% R:5
lrhzbil CF johedugfp 2025-02-22